          Current Employment for First-Line Supervisors of Non-Retail Sales Workers in WISCONSIN

          Rank Region 2024 Employment
          1 Milwaukee-Waukesha, WI Metro Area 1,930
          2 Minneapolis-St. Paul-Bloomington, MN-WI Metro Area 1,920
          3 Madison, WI Metro Area 900
          4 Green Bay, WI Metro Area 380
          5 South Central Wisconsin Balance of State 360
          6 Appleton, WI Metro Area 310
          7 Northeastern Wisconsin Balance of State 250
          8 Oshkosh-Neenah, WI Metro Area 210
          9 Western Wisconsin Balance of State 200
          10 Eau Claire, WI Metro Area 160
          11 Racine-Mount Pleasant, WI Metro Area 150
          12 Wausau, WI Metro Area 150
          13 Janesville-Beloit, WI Metro Area 140
          14 La Crosse-Onalaska, WI-MN Metro Area 140
          15 Kenosha, WI Metro Area 130
          16 Fond du Lac, WI Metro Area 110
          17 Sheboygan, WI Metro Area 90
          18 Duluth, MN-WI Metro Area 80
          19 Northwestern Wisconsin Balance of State 70
